Abstract

Antibiotics that are often added to animal feed have the function of increasing productivity, reducing mortality and improving the efficiency of feed use. The use of antibiotics can leave a residue and endanger health. One way to anticipate this problem is by stopping the use of antibiotics in rations by trying to find natural ingredients that have the same function as antibiotics but do not leave a residue on the products produced. This research was conducted from July to September 2018 at the Experimental Cage of Animal Husbandry Study Program and Laboratory of Nutrition and Animal Feeding, Faculty of Agriculture, Sriwijaya University. The design used was a completely randomized design (CRD) with 5 treatments and 4 replications. Treatment (P1) pineapple waste 100%, (P2) 98% pineapple waste : 2% Indigofera zollingeriana, (P3): 96% pineapple waste : 4% Indigofera zollingeriana, (P4): 94% pineapple waste : 6% Indigofera zollingeriana, (P5): 92% pineapple waste : 8% Indigofera zollingeriana. The parameters observed were dry matter digestibility, crude fiber digestibility and crude protein digestibility in-vitro. The results showed that the addition of supernatant from liquid fermented pineapple waste and leaves of Indigofera zollingeriana into the ration had a significant effect (P <0.05) on the digestibility of crude fiber and crude protein in vitro. Based on the results of the study it can be concluded that the best combination is 92% pineapple waste: 8% Indigofera zollingeriana because it can increase digestibility of crude protein, crude fiber and dry matter.
